This project provides a Python implementation for optimizing IP-to-ASN lookups together with memory usage. It includes a Trie data structure to efficiently store IP ranges and their corresponding ASN information, as well as a command-line interface for user interaction.
- Ensure you have Python installed on your system.
- Download the project files and place them in a directory.
- Option 1: Using Your Own Data File
• In the project directory, create a data file containing IP-to-ASN mapping data. Each line should follow the format:
start_ip end_ip asn country as_name
Here's an example line:
16777216 16777471 13335 US CLOUDFLARENET
• In the main() function of the main.py file, specify the name of your data file by replacing 'ip2asn-v4-u32.tsv' in the line:
mapper = IPtoASNMapper('ip2asn-v4-u32.tsv')
with the name of your data file. - Option 2: Using the Embedded Data File
• If you want to use the embedded data file included in the project, no further configuration is needed.
The embedded data file is named 'ip2asn-v4-u32.tsv'. - Open a terminal or command prompt and navigate to the project directory.
- Run the following command to execute the program: python main.py
- The program will prompt you to enter an IP address containing only digits. You can enter multiple IP addresses one after another.
• To exit the program, type "q" and press Enter.
• If you enter an invalid IP address or encounter an error, an error message will be displayed. - The program will perform the IP-to-ASN lookup for each valid IP address and display the corresponding ASN.
Here are five examples of how the data should be formatted in the data file:
16777216 16777471 13335 US CLOUDFLARENET
16777472 16778239 0 None Not routed
16778240 16778751 38803 AU WPL-AS-AP Wirefreebroadband Pty Ltd
16778752 16779263 38803 AU WPL-AS-AP Wirefreebroadband Pty Ltd
16779264 16781311 0 None Not routed
Ensure that your data file follows this format, with each line representing an IP range and its associated ASN information.
